Kinetic studies on the reactions of methyl (MBS) and ethyl benzenesulphonates (EBS) with N,N-dimethylanilines (DMA) in methanol and acetonitrile are reported. The cross interaction constants ρXZ and βXZ, between the substituents in the nucleophile (X) and the leaving group (Z) indicated that the transition states (TS) are looser than those for the reactions with anilines, but the relative tightness between the two substrates was the same; the TS was tighter for EBS despite the increase in steric effect leading to looser TSs for MBS and EBS alike. The TS variation between two different reaction series expected from the simple Hammett and Brønsted coefficients, ρX, ρZ, βX and βZ, was incompatible with that predicted by the cross interaction constants, demonstrating again the unreliability of the simple parameters.
